no, I'm kind of thinking out loud...But, and I'm being completely honest here, why not just completely not be willing to go all-in early in a tournament unless you have the best possible hand? I don't understand why you would want to go all in if you might lose so early on in a tourney...
Assume that you're an average player- that means you have a 50% chance of doubling up in a tournament. If you're better, then you have slightly more of a chance of doubling up in an average tourney. NO PLAYER IS GOOD ENOUGH TO DOUBLE UP IN 80% OF THE TOURNAMENTS. Therefore, you have to take that 4-1 edge.
